The epidemiological and clinical importance of bone metastasis has
long been recognized, but the past decade has seen an explosion in the
fields of bone biology and bone cancer research. This period of time
has been marked by a number of key discoveries that have led to the
opening up of entirely new areas for investigation as well as new
therapies which combine surgery and biological therapeutic approaches.
Bone is a common site of cancer metastases - cancer cells commonly
develop in bone and spread to other organ systems through the
bloodstream. For example, the incidence of bone metastases in breast
and prostate cancers is 70%, whereas it is only 30 to 40% in metastatic
lung cancer. In clinical terms, bone metastases have substantial
negative effects on a patient's quality of life and are a main cause of
patient mortality. Given the global prevalence of breast and prostate
cancers, knowledge of bone biology has become essential for the medical
and cancer research communities. This book provides, all in one
resource, the most recent data on bone cancer development (cellular and
molecular mechanisms), genomic and proteomic analyses, clinical
analyses (histopathology, imaging, pain monitoring), as well as new
therapeutic approaches and clinical trials for primary bone tumors and
bone metastases.
